The Ninth US Circuit Court of Appeals in California has ruled that the low-frequency active sonar (LFA) systems used by the US Navy for training missions violates the Marine Mammal protection Act, and negatively impacts whales, dolphins, and walruses who rely on sound to navigate the seas.
